Powder Room Fan Installation in Denver County, CO
Powder room fan installation involves adding or upgrading ventilation fans in small bathrooms, typically those used as guest or half baths. This service covers projects such as replacing outdated or inefficient fans, installing new units to improve airflow, and ensuring proper ductwork and wiring connections. Homeowners often seek this service to reduce humidity, eliminate odors, and improve overall bathroom air quality, especially in spaces where moisture buildup can lead to mold or damage.
Before requesting powder room fan installation, property owners should consider the size of the bathroom, the type of fan needed, and the existing electrical setup. It’s helpful to understand whether the space requires a fan with a humidity sensor, a quiet operation, or additional features like lighting. Clarifying these details can ensure the right ventilation solution is selected to meet the specific needs of the bathroom and property.

Powder Room Fan Installation Questions
What is involved in installing a powder room fan? The process typically includes selecting an appropriate fan, creating or modifying ductwork, and ensuring proper venting to the outside.
Why should a powder room have a dedicated exhaust fan? A dedicated fan helps remove moisture and odors effectively, maintaining a fresh and healthy bathroom environment.
Can existing ventilation be upgraded with a new fan? Yes, existing ventilation systems can often be upgraded to improve airflow and efficiency with a new fan installation.
What types of fans are suitable for powder rooms? Quiet, compact exhaust fans with good airflow capacity are commonly used for powder room installations.
